Chou Associates Management Inc. bought a new stake in shares of Methanex Corporation (NASDAQ:MEOH – Free Report) (TSE:MX) during the second qu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The institutional investor bought 20,000 shares of the specialty chemicals company’s stock, valued at approximately $924,000. Methanex accounts for 0.4% of Chou Associates Management Inc.’s portfolio, making the stock its 22nd biggest position.

Methanex Announces Dividend
The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, September 30th. Shareholders of record on Wednesday, September 16th will be paid a $0.185 dividend. This represents a $0.74 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.2%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, September 16th. Methanex’s payout ratio is presently 71.84%.

About Methanex
Methanex Corporation is a Vancouver, Canada–based company and one of the world’s largest producers and suppliers of methanol. The company manufactures methanol, a key feedstock for a wide range of chemical products and industrial applications. Methanex markets its product to customers in energy, plastics, paints and coatings, and various chemical sectors, positioning the company as a critical link in the global supply chain for basic chemicals.
The company’s core product, methanol, serves as a building block for downstream chemicals such as formaldehyde, acetic acid and methyl tertiary butyl ether (MTBE).
